CRA’s 4th Wednesday Rental Workshop will return via Zoom on February 26, 2025, from 2:30-4 p.m.
CYRP and Peter Sloan will be hosting this month’s workshop: HR Solutions Lab: Critical Employment Issues & People Centered-Practices
     Presented by California Young Rental Professionals and Peter Sloan, HR Solutions Lab focuses on addressing critical employment issues while promoting people-centered practices. By combining expertise in human resources with innovative solutions, it helps organizations navigate complex challenges and foster a supportive work environment. Their approach prioritizes the well-being and growth of employees, ensuring a balanced and effective workforce that drives organizational success.
     Training for the FREE MEMBER BENEFIT runs an hour. Participants have a chance to win a $50 Amazon gift card during the drawing held at the end of the workshop.

A landmark Supreme Court decision. A polarized electorate. ESG in the crosshairs. These factors and others are putting Corporate America’s diversity efforts on defense like never before. Despite the scrutiny, these programs continue to receive strong support from employees, according to new survey data from The Conference Board. Indeed, 58% of US workers believe their organization devotes the appropriate level of effort and resources to their DEI initiatives; 21% don’t believe their organization’s efforts go far enough.
The study also explores the views of workers for whose benefit these efforts are intended: nearly half of women (49%) and Black (56%) respondents say they wouldn’t work for a company that does not take DEI seriously.

A special edition compact track loader from CNH construction brand CASE Construction Equipment was on display at the YouTube Theater in Inglewood, California, at the Helping Hands charity concert. Held on December 13, this annual event is organized by the rock band Metallica’s All Within My Hands charitable foundation. Following its debut, this custom-designed CASE TV450B compact track loader is destined for use at the ranch of Metallica frontman and co-founder James Hetfield. Hetfield commissioned the design as part of an equipment supply agreement with our CASE brand.

United Rentals, Inc. and H&E Equipment Services, Inc. recently announced their entry into a definitive agreement under which United Rentals will acquire H&E for $92 per share in cash, reflecting a total enterprise value of approximately $4.8 billion, including approximately $1.4 billion of net debt. 
   Founded in 1961, H&E provides its customers with a comprehensive mix of high-quality general rental fleet including aerial work platforms, earthmoving equipment, material handling equipment, and other general and specialty lines of equipment. With approximately 2,900 employees and $2.9 billion of rental fleet at original cost, the company serves a diverse mix of customers across both construction and industrial markets through its network of approximately 160 branches in over 30 U.S. states.
   The transaction is consistent with United Rentals’ “grow the core” strategy, and legacy H&E customers will benefit from one-stop access to United Rentals’ specialty rental offerings across Fluid Solutions, Matting Solutions, Onsite Services, Portable Storage & Modular Space, Power & HVAC, Tool Solutions, and Trench Safety.
   H&E’s fleet, experienced employees and customer service footprint of branches across over 30 strategic U.S. states are complementary with United Rentals’ existing network. Importantly, the combination will increase capacity for United Rentals in key U.S. geographies.
   The combination will expand United Rentals’ rental fleet by almost 64,000 units with an original cost of over $2.9 billion and an average age of under 41 months, as well as roughly $230 million of non-rental fleet.
    United Rentals and H&E share many cultural attributes, including a strong focus on safety, a customer-first business philosophy, and best practices for talent development and retention. Critically, H&E employees will bring a wealth of experience to United Rentals, and will have greater opportunities for career development within the larger combined organization.
